If you call the ATIS during the day at KLAX (310-646-2297, IIRC; check at Airnav), you will normally hear the following:
Simultaneous ILS approaches are in progress to runways 24R and 25L, or vector for visual approach will be provided; simultaneous visual approaches to all runways are in progress, and parallel localizer approaches are in progress between Los Angeles International Airport and Hawthorn Airport. Simultaneous instrument departures are in progress for runways 24 and 25.
Under normal ops, they land and depart all runways at KLAX; even when they flip the boat, they land and depart the 6s and 7s. The only time runways are closed are during suicide/noise abatement ops between Midnight local and 6:30am, when they will land 6R and depart 25R.
